Instructions to Los Alamos Computers for Configuring Workstations

Kernel

  • Install latest kernel and previous kernel, selectable at boot with default being the latest kernel

Additional packages to install on all machines

  1. xemacs
  2. wv
  3. antiword
  4. xless
  5. sylpheed (NOTE: must use apt-get -t unstable install sylpheed)
  6. sylpheed-doc (also for unstable)
  7. muttprint
  8. mozilla-firebird
  9. nedit
  10. abiword (from unstable)
  11. kile
  12. knotes (a KDE package)
  13. hevea
  14. dillo
  15. cupsys-bsd (makes lpr available, if LAC has not already added this)
  16. firestarter (don't configure or start)
  17. Try to update cups to include drivers for HP Laserjet 4000N and HP Color Laserjet 4500. If this is difficult to do, the builtin driver for HP 4 series works pretty well for the 4000N. NOTE We are ordering a Xerox Phaser 6250/DP color laser printer which has a CUPS driver available from Xerox. If possible it would be nice to have this driver installed. See http://www.office.xerox.com/cgi-bin/DriverD.pl?printer_type=6250.
  18. Servers to activate: sshd, samba
  19. Run gdmconfig; in security tab uncheck "Secure System Menu" then Close

Additional packages to install on configuration # 2 (for analysts):

  • Add the following line to /etc/apt/sources.list:
    deb http://cran.us.r-project.org/bin/linux/debian sarge main
  • apt-get install r-base, r-doc-pdf, r-recommended
